The vibration level and noise emission value given
in these instructions have been measured in ac-
cordance with a standardised measuring proced-
ure and may be used to compare power tools.
They may also be used for a preliminary estima-
tion of vibration and noise emissions.
The stated vibration level and noise emission
value represent the main applications of the
power tool. However, if the power tool is used for
other applications, with different application tools
